The original sentence is already in the active voice. To arrange the pieces without changing the meaning or tense, we can simply re - order the adverbial phrase. The basic structure of an active - voice sentence is "Subject + Verb + Object + (Adverbial)". Here, the subject is "Taylor McKessie's neighbor", the verb is "whispers", the object is "the secret spy password", and the adverbial is "at the clubhouse entrance". We can move the adverbial to the beginning of the sentence.

Answer:

  1. At the clubhouse entrance, Taylor McKessie's neighbor whispers the secret spy password.
  2. Taylor McKessie's neighbor whispers the secret spy password at the clubhouse entrance.
